为什么编程要用特殊符号
-
编程使用特殊符号是为了实现一种计算机语言,这种语言可以被计算机理解和执行。特殊符号在编程中起到了非常重要的作用,它们用于表示不同的指令、操作和数据类型。以下是几个原因解释了为什么编程要用特殊符号。
-
表达清晰和简洁
特殊符号可以让代码更加简洁和易读。相比于使用自然语言,特殊符号可以更精确地表达程序的逻辑和功能。例如,使用"+"符号可以表示加法操作,使用"="符号可以表示赋值操作,这些符号可以让代码更加简洁明了。 -
提高效率和准确性
编程中使用特殊符号可以提高编程效率和准确性。特殊符号通常是通过键盘上的特殊按键或者组合键来输入的,相比于使用自然语言来描述代码,使用特殊符号可以更快速地输入和编辑代码。此外,特殊符号在编程语言中有着固定的含义和规则,这样可以避免一些语法错误,提高程序的准确性。 -
与计算机内部结构对应
特殊符号在编程中与计算机内部结构之间存在一定的对应关系。计算机内部使用二进制来表示数据和指令,而特殊符号则是一种抽象的表示方式,可以将人类的思维和计算机的运算联系起来。例如,"="符号可以表示赋值操作,这与计算机内部的存储和传输数据的操作相对应。 -
统一的标准和约定
编程中使用特殊符号有助于建立统一的标准和约定。不同的编程语言可能会使用不同的特殊符号,但是在同一种编程语言中,特殊符号的含义是固定的。这样可以建立起一套统一的编程规范,使得不同的程序员可以更容易地理解和交流代码。
综上所述,编程使用特殊符号是为了实现一种计算机语言,它可以让代码更加清晰简洁,提高编程效率和准确性,与计算机内部结构对应,并建立统一的标准和约定。特殊符号在编程中起到了非常重要的作用,是编程语言不可或缺的一部分。
1年前 -
-
编程使用特殊符号的原因有很多,下面是五个主要原因:
-
符号的简洁性:编程语言使用特殊符号可以将复杂的操作和逻辑表达简化为简洁的代码。特殊符号可以用来表示数学运算、逻辑判断、控制流程等,使得代码更加易读、易懂、易写。
-
符号的标准化:编程语言中的特殊符号具有统一的含义和规范用法。这些符号被广泛接受和使用,使得程序员之间可以更好地交流和理解彼此的代码。符号的标准化还有助于编程语言的发展和演化,使得新的语言特性可以通过引入新的符号来实现。
-
符号的表达力:特殊符号可以更准确地表达程序的逻辑和功能。例如,数学符号可以用来表示数值计算和算术运算,逻辑符号可以用来表示条件判断和布尔运算,标点符号可以用来表示程序的结构和控制流程。这些符号使得程序的含义更加明确,避免了歧义和误解。
-
符号的易于识别:特殊符号通常由非常独特的形状和结构组成,使得它们在代码中很容易被识别和区分。这样可以减少程序员在阅读和理解代码时的认知负担,提高编程效率和准确性。
-
符号的可扩展性:编程语言通常允许程序员自定义和扩展特殊符号的含义和用法。这使得程序员可以根据自己的需求和习惯来定义符号,以及创建新的符号来实现特定的功能和效果。符号的可扩展性为编程语言提供了更大的灵活性和自由度,使得程序员可以更好地适应不同的编程场景和需求。
1年前 -
-
编程中使用特殊符号是为了表达特定的意义和功能。特殊符号可以帮助程序员清晰地定义和描述代码的逻辑结构和操作流程,使代码更易读、易维护和易扩展。
下面是一些常见的特殊符号及其在编程中的作用:
-
括号:括号在编程中用于标识代码块的开始和结束。大括号{}用于定义函数、类、循环等的开始和结束,小括号()用于函数和方法的参数列表。
-
分号:分号用于分隔代码的不同部分,表示语句的结束。在某些编程语言中,每个语句必须以分号结尾。
-
等号:等号用于赋值操作,将一个值赋给一个变量。例如,x = 10表示将值10赋给变量x。
-
加号、减号、乘号、除号:这些符号用于数学运算,例如加法、减法、乘法和除法。在编程中,它们也可以用于字符串的拼接、列表的合并等操作。
-
小于号、大于号、等于号:这些符号用于比较操作,用于判断两个值的关系。例如,x < y表示x小于y,x == y表示x等于y。
-
逻辑运算符:逻辑运算符用于对布尔值进行运算。例如,与运算符&&表示逻辑与,或运算符||表示逻辑或,非运算符!表示逻辑非。
-
方括号:方括号用于访问列表、数组和字典等数据结构中的元素。例如,list[0]表示访问列表list的第一个元素。
-
反斜杠:反斜杠用于转义字符,表示特殊的字符含义。例如,\n表示换行符,\t表示制表符。
-
点号:点号用于访问对象的属性或调用对象的方法。例如,object.property表示访问对象的属性,object.method()表示调用对象的方法。
特殊符号的使用使得编程语言更加丰富和灵活,可以表达更复杂的逻辑和功能。同时,特殊符号的规范使用也有助于降低代码错误的发生率,提高代码的可读性和可维护性。因此,在编程中使用特殊符号是必要且重要的。
1年前 -